NAME
     hivexget - Get subkey from a Windows Registry binary "hive" file

SYNOPSIS
      hivexget hivefile '\Path\To\SubKey'

      hivexget hivefile '\Path\To\SubKey' name

NOTE
     This is a low-level tool.	For a more convenient way to navigate the Win-
     dows Registry in Windows virtual machines, see virt-win-reg(1).  For proper
     regedit formatting, use hivexregedit(1).

DESCRIPTION
     This program navigates through a Windows Registry binary "hive" file and
     extracts either all the (key, value) data pairs stored in that subkey or
     just the single named data item.

     In the first form:

      hivexget hivefile '\Path\To\SubKey'

     "hivefile" is some Windows Registry binary hive, and "\Path\To\Subkey" is a
     path within that hive.  NB the path is relative to the top of this hive,
     and is not the full path as you would use in Windows (eg. "HKEY_LOCAL_MA-
     CHINE\SYSTEM" is not a valid path).

     If the subkey exists, then the output lists all data pairs under this sub-
     key, in a format similar to "regedit" in Windows.

     In the second form:

      hivexget hivefile '\Path\To\SubKey' name

     "hivefile" and path are as above.	"name" is the name of the value of in-
     terest (use "@" for the default value).

     The corresponding data item is printed "raw" (ie. no processing or escap-
     ing) except:

     1.  If it's a string we will convert it from Windows UTF-16 to UTF-8, if
	 this conversion is possible.  The string is printed with a single
	 trailing newline.

     2.  If it's a multiple-string value, each string is printed on a separate
	 line.

     3.  If it's a numeric value, it is printed as a decimal number.
